So You Want to Own a Baseball Team (feat. Rob Mains)

1–2 minutes

Bobby and Alex kick off the new year by bringing on Rob Mains, writer at Baseball Prospectus, to talk about the business of baseball from an owner’s perspective, how teams actually make (and lose) money, what’s changed about owners in the last 50 years, and much more.
